syuilo
abddd40c09
enhance(frontend): 通常のRouterViewにTransitionを追加
2025-03-20 18:55:32 +09:00
かっこかり
a865a949b5
fix(frontend): MkRoleSelectDialogでのpopupの使い方が誤っているのを修正 ( #15683 )
2025-03-20 16:36:37 +09:00
syuilo
0007723405
fix lint
2025-03-20 16:34:50 +09:00
syuilo
71188b3463
fix lint
2025-03-20 16:10:38 +09:00
syuilo
7f534a41a6
fix lint
2025-03-20 16:07:52 +09:00
syuilo
fd3e28812e
clean up console
2025-03-20 15:15:46 +09:00
syuilo
3399c786a8
refactor(frontend): refactor components
2025-03-20 13:33:01 +09:00
syuilo
8b6d90b7a4
🎨
2025-03-20 13:16:08 +09:00
syuilo
282caa0b7e
🎨 for install-extensions
2025-03-20 12:36:48 +09:00
syuilo
b067d4dcd6
follow up of 7b323031b7
2025-03-20 08:59:54 +09:00
syuilo
b37622fa64
🎨
2025-03-19 20:54:07 +09:00
syuilo
7b323031b7
refactor(frontend): use useTemplateRef for DOM referencing
2025-03-19 18:46:03 +09:00
syuilo
81ac71f7e5
refactor(frontend): router refactoring
2025-03-19 18:06:22 +09:00
syuilo
409cd4fbd3
refactor(frontend): router refactoring
2025-03-19 15:54:30 +09:00
syuilo
7d4045e8b4
refactor(frontend): router refactoring
2025-03-19 15:24:56 +09:00
syuilo
bdc72e5817
clean up
2025-03-19 15:17:41 +09:00
syuilo
11378b17c5
🎨
2025-03-19 09:31:01 +09:00
syuilo
62bf0d53d3
🎨
2025-03-18 22:21:28 +09:00
syuilo
05391f59a5
enhance(frontend): improve StackingRouterView
2025-03-18 20:55:19 +09:00
syuilo
d609f41f61
🎨
2025-03-18 17:31:25 +09:00
syuilo
0a295e1bb0
🎨
2025-03-18 15:23:50 +09:00
syuilo
a773f2976d
refactor(frontend): signinRequired -> ensureSignin
2025-03-16 19:04:14 +09:00
syuilo
22b0ace8b4
enhance(frontend): 投稿フォームの設定メニューを改良 (改)
...
This reverts commit a814395127
.
2025-03-16 17:48:16 +09:00
syuilo
a814395127
Revert "enhance(frontend): 投稿フォームの設定メニューを改良 ( #14804 )"
...
This reverts commit ce6b2448ce
.
2025-03-16 17:21:20 +09:00
syuilo
81a0cbd294
chore(frontend): use toast to show message when call copyToClipboard
2025-03-16 15:04:38 +09:00
syuilo
32844e4775
🎨
2025-03-16 14:56:27 +09:00
かっこかり
ce6b2448ce
enhance(frontend): 投稿フォームの設定メニューを改良 ( #14804 )
...
* enhance(frontend): 投稿フォームの設定メニューを改良
* Update Changelog
* indent
* MkMenuのitemを切り出して共通化
* remove unused expose
* fix: ドロワーなどのOptionが当たらない問題を修正
* 他のpopupMenuの項目選択時と挙動をあわせる
* チュートリアルで詰む問題を修正
* Revert "MkMenuのitemを切り出して共通化"
This reverts commit ce3679798c
.
* enhance: slotで共通化
* Update MkPostFormOtherMenu.vue
* remove duplicated locale key
* refactor: メニューの定義をMkPostForm側で行うように
* Update CHANGELOG.md
* [ci skip] Update MkPostFormOtherMenu.vue
* Update MkPostForm.vue
* Update CHANGELOG.md
---------
Co-authored-by: syuilo <4439005+syuilo@users.noreply.github.com >
2025-03-16 05:05:58 +00:00
syuilo
dca42fd6e6
enhance(frontend): improve ux for touch devices
2025-03-16 13:59:08 +09:00
syuilo
43153311c6
🎨
2025-03-16 13:43:47 +09:00
syuilo
c2940fd77c
enhance(frontend): improve usability on touch device
2025-03-16 10:58:06 +09:00
syuilo
2ddedd0ce6
refactor
2025-03-14 19:54:30 +09:00
syuilo
8c9ec5827f
enhance(frontend): improve accounts management
2025-03-13 22:12:23 +09:00
syuilo
44073736de
enhance(frontend): improve preferences
2025-03-13 19:44:23 +09:00
syuilo
10b67e1b3a
enhance(frontend): improve emoji picker settings
2025-03-13 16:56:47 +09:00
syuilo
3ced310f77
refactor(frontend): organize use functions
2025-03-13 14:05:04 +09:00
syuilo
ce6eba77d9
🎨
2025-03-13 09:07:22 +09:00
syuilo
f8e244f48d
enhance(frontend): アカウントオーバーライド設定とデバイス間同期の併用に対応
2025-03-12 14:34:10 +09:00
syuilo
caab1ec7c3
🎨
2025-03-12 13:04:41 +09:00
syuilo
b03bcf26cd
enhance(frontend): 設定値の同期を実装(実験的)
2025-03-12 11:39:05 +09:00
syuilo
d185785f20
enhance(frontend): improve settings page
2025-03-11 14:52:04 +09:00
syuilo
02d7fbefc4
🎨
2025-03-11 12:08:15 +09:00
ろむねこ
6841cdfa76
enhance(frontend): CWの注釈テキストが入力されていない場合はPostボタンを非アクティブに ( #15639 )
...
* add condition to disable post button when CW text is empty
* standardize condition by using 1<= inserted of 0<
* unify CW text length condition to improve readability
* add missing CW state check
* fix state check, add empty/null check, improve max length validation
* simplify CW validation by removing minimum length check
* Update CHANGELOG
* remove CW text validation in post()
---------
Co-authored-by: syuilo <4439005+syuilo@users.noreply.github.com >
2025-03-10 10:35:37 +00:00
かっこかり
f797765b1d
enhance(frontend): テーマ設定で簡易プレビューを表示するように ( #15643 )
...
* enhance(frontend): テーマ設定で簡易プレビューを表示するように
* Update Changelog
* fix lint
* 🎨
---------
Co-authored-by: syuilo <4439005+syuilo@users.noreply.github.com >
2025-03-10 09:35:51 +00:00
syuilo
9e91f85370
refactor(frontend): use Symbol for vue provide/inject
2025-03-10 15:08:40 +09:00
syuilo
9998cb84e8
refactor(frontend): page-metadata -> page
2025-03-10 13:47:38 +09:00
syuilo
b200743845
refactor(frontend): rename store.set -> store.commit
2025-03-10 11:27:07 +09:00
syuilo
08f7e7d9b3
refactor(frontend): rename pizzax fields
2025-03-10 10:51:54 +09:00
syuilo
4df9083bf0
fix(frontend): テーマ切り替え時に一部の色が変わらない問題を修正
2025-03-10 10:05:50 +09:00
taichan
6419af2179
fix(frontend, dev): storybookのビルドエラー修正のため、as構文にリファクタ ( #15640 )
2025-03-10 09:34:45 +09:00
syuilo
d9858b03c9
enhance(frontend): improve plugin management
2025-03-10 09:28:07 +09:00